Dental practices in this size range face unique pressures. Margins are squeezed by rising lab costs, staffing shortages, and increasing patient expectations for digital convenience. Pediatric patients add scheduling complexity with school-hour preferences and guardian coordination, while adult patients demand cosmetic and implant services with higher case values. AI adoption in dentistry remains low compared to other healthcare segments, creating a significant first-mover advantage for groups willing to modernize. The key is targeting high-friction, repetitive processes that directly affect revenue and patient satisfaction.

Three concrete AI opportunities with ROI framing

1. Predictive scheduling and no-show reduction. No-shows and last-minute cancellations cost the average dental practice 10-15% of daily revenue. An AI model trained on historical appointment data, patient demographics, weather, and even local traffic patterns can predict which slots are at risk. Automated, personalized reminders via SMS or email can then be triggered, and high-risk slots can be double-booked strategically. For a group this size, reducing no-shows by just 20% could recover $300,000-$500,000 annually in otherwise lost production.

2. Intelligent revenue cycle management. Insurance verification and claims submission remain heavily manual in most dental offices. AI can verify eligibility in real-time during check-in, flag coding errors before submission, and even predict denial likelihood based on payer behavior. This reduces the 5-10% denial rate typical in dentistry and shortens the reimbursement cycle by several days. For an $18 million revenue base, a 3% improvement in collections represents over $500,000 in accelerated cash flow.

3. AI-driven patient reactivation and recall. The hygiene recall system is the heartbeat of a dental practice. AI can segment overdue patients by lapse reason, household income, insurance status, and past treatment acceptance to craft personalized reactivation campaigns. Instead of generic postcards, patients receive timely, relevant messages that bring them back. A 15% improvement in recall effectiveness can add $700,000+ in annual production from hygiene and diagnosed treatment alone.

Deployment risks specific to this size band

Mid-market dental groups face distinct challenges when adopting AI. First, integration with legacy practice management systems like Dentrix or Eaglesoft can be technically messy; choose vendors with proven, pre-built connectors. Second, staff resistance is real—front desk teams may fear job displacement. Mitigate this by positioning AI as a co-pilot that eliminates drudgery, not a replacement. Third, HIPAA compliance cannot be an afterthought. Every AI vendor handling PHI must sign a BAA and demonstrate robust security practices. Finally, avoid the temptation to deploy too many tools at once. Start with one high-ROI use case like scheduling or claims, prove the value, then expand. A phased approach builds internal buy-in and reduces operational disruption.

Common questions about AI for dental practices & clinics

Is AI in dentistry compliant with HIPAA?
Yes, if you use vendors that sign Business Associate Agreements (BAAs) and offer encryption, access controls, and audit logs. Always verify compliance before deployment.
How can AI reduce patient no-shows?
AI models analyze appointment history, weather, traffic, and demographics to predict no-shows, then trigger tailored reminders or offer easy rescheduling, reducing missed appointments by up to 30%.
Will AI replace our front desk staff?
No. AI handles repetitive tasks like confirmations and FAQs, freeing staff to focus on in-person patient experience, complex scheduling, and treatment coordination.
What is the ROI of AI claims processing?
Practices typically see a 15-20% reduction in claim denials and a 3-5 day faster reimbursement cycle, directly improving cash flow and reducing administrative rework.
Can AI help with patient reactivation?
Yes, AI segments patients by lapse reason and propensity to return, then automates personalized email/SMS sequences. Reactivation rates often improve by 20-25%.
Do we need a large IT team to adopt AI?
No. Most dental AI tools are cloud-based and integrate with existing practice management systems like Dentrix or Eaglesoft, requiring minimal IT support.
How does AI improve treatment acceptance?
AI generates visual simulations and clear, jargon-free explanations of procedures, helping patients understand value and urgency, which can lift case acceptance by 15-25%.
